Output 43b55fc2193c2f39efd225f3ec7b0c79b155ab22911ea6fb6c4d01c864db1e2a:0

value
1537799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b95c318e8ae3963779a2d6b6d199fdea6693aa OP_EQUAL
address
34rcx7YhNuwqhQyxcEZURv81EEqp5BV9ci
transaction
43b55fc2193c2f39efd225f3ec7b0c79b155ab22911ea6fb6c4d01c864db1e2a
spent
true